MediaCom to run Edinburgh conference examining marketing effectiveness

Next month MediaCom Edinburgh is to stage an event examining how effective marketing can be through digital platforms and the most effective way of utilising online methods, with input from speakers from companies such as Experian, Google and Sky.

The what Works Now? Marketing Effectiveness in the Data Age, will take place on 3 November, and will include talks by Andrew McIntosh, head of brand strategy at Sky, Justin Armsworth, who oversees the marketing services division of Experian Scotland, Clare Newman, head of business science EMEA for MediaCom, Mark Riseley, group product marketing manager for the EMEA Market Insights team at Google, strategic planner and consultant Peter Field and John Thekanady, head of client Services at Compete, Kantar’s Digital Intelligence agency.

Each presentation will be followed by a Q&A session.

The event will take place at the Hawthornden Lecture Theatre at the National Galleries Complex from 9am on 3 November.
